Manhattan Beach, CA : Market Snapshot November 8, 2009

Manhattan Beach, CA homes for sale, in escrow and sold as of Novermber 8, 2008

Downtown Manhattan Beach

Traditionally November and December are our slowest real estate months. In the best of times people are more concerned with the upcoming holidays then buying a new home. The recent turmoil in the financial markets and worries about recession along with concerns on policies a new President will add to the mix, may add up to the lowest sales volume we have seen in Manhattan Beach and the Beach Cities in a long time.

Sales in October turned out better then expected with 21 homes and 5 townhomes closing escrow by the end of the month. November is looking a bit bleak, no doubt reflecting the turmoil of September and October. As of today no homes or townhomes have actually closed escrow since November 1, 2008.

Pending sales look a bit better... there are currently 26 pending home sales (5 since Nov 1) and 6 pending townhome sales (2 since Nov 1). Inventory is about the same with 176 homes and 38 townhomes for sale.

There is no doubt consumers are pulling back. Last Sunday I went to the Pacific Theatres and there were not many people in the theatre and no line at PF Chang's... there is always a line at PF Changs. My Hair guy tells me his business is off by 10%. Macy's has a new sale every week. Even Nordstrom is heavily promoting sale items. With luck the South Bay will weather the recession better then other areas but we will defintiely be affected.

While home prices in Manhattan Beach are coming down the market remains on the high side. There are 11 home for sale in east Manhattan that are priced at less then a million. A "C " location tree section lot hit the market today at $799,000. This is the only property for sale under $1M West of Sepulveda. Keep an eye on this one. In the mid-market level there are 83 homes for sale under $2M. 40 of those homes are priced between $1M and $1.5 M. At the other end of the spectrum there are 15 homes priced over $5M and 5 of those are priced over $7 million.
